利用人类大脑类器官研究应激相关机制和疾病的伦理问题。

Ethical Implications in Making Use of Human Cerebral Organoids for Investigating Stress-Related Mechanisms and Disorders.

作者信息

Bassil Katherine, Horstkötter Dorothee

机构信息

Department of Psychiatry and Neuropsychology, Maastricht University, Maastricht, The Netherlands.

Department of Health Ethics and Society, Maastricht University, Maastricht, The Netherlands.

出版信息

Camb Q Healthc Ethics. 2023 Feb 17:1-13. doi: 10.1017/S0963180123000038.

DOI:10.1017/S0963180123000038
PMID:36799029
Abstract

The generation of three-dimensional cerebral organoids from human-induced pluripotent stem cells (hPSC) has facilitated the investigation of mechanisms underlying several neuropsychiatric disorders, including stress-related disorders, namely major depressive disorder and post-traumatic stress disorder. Generating hPSC-derived neurons, cerebral organoids, and even assembloids (or multi-organoid complexes) can facilitate research into biomarkers for stress susceptibility or resilience and may even bring about advances in personalized medicine and biomarker research for stress-related psychiatric disorders. Nevertheless, cerebral organoid research does not come without its own set of ethical considerations. With increased complexity and resemblance to in vivo conditions, discussions of increased moral status for these models are ongoing, including questions about sentience, consciousness, moral status, donor protection, and chimeras. There are, however, unique ethical considerations that arise and are worth looking into in the context of research into stress and stress-related disorders using cerebral organoids. This paper provides stress research-specific ethical considerations in the context of cerebral organoid generation and use for research purposes. The use of stress research as a case study here can help inform other practices of in vitro studies using brain models with high ethical considerations.

摘要

从人诱导多能干细胞(hPSC)生成三维脑类器官,有助于研究包括应激相关障碍(即重度抑郁症和创伤后应激障碍)在内的几种神经精神疾病的潜在机制。生成hPSC来源的神经元、脑类器官,甚至组装体(或多器官oid复合体),可以促进对应激易感性或恢复力生物标志物的研究,甚至可能在应激相关精神疾病的个性化医学和生物标志物研究方面取得进展。然而,脑类器官研究也有其自身的一系列伦理考量。随着这些模型与体内条件的复杂性和相似性增加,关于这些模型道德地位提高的讨论正在进行,包括关于感知、意识、道德地位、供体保护和嵌合体的问题。然而,在使用脑类器官进行应激和应激相关障碍研究的背景下,会出现一些独特的伦理考量,值得深入研究。本文在脑类器官生成及用于研究目的的背景下,提供了应激研究特有的伦理考量。将应激研究作为案例研究,有助于为其他具有高度伦理考量的脑模型体外研究实践提供参考。
